____________ is responsible for performing all the arithmetic computations such as addition, subtraction, division, multiplication and exponentiation.

  1. Memory unit

  2. Control unit

  3. Arithmetic and Logic unit

  4. Both a and b

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
C Correct answer
Explanation

The Arithmetic and Logic Unit (ALU) is the part of the CPU responsible for performing all mathematical calculations and logical operations.

___________________ provides online outcome in the form of information and reports without time lag between the transaction and its processing.

  1. Processing

  2. Batch Processing

  3. Real-Time Processing

  4. Both a and b

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
C Correct answer
Explanation

Real-time processing systems process data immediately as it arrives, providing near-instantaneous output without the delay associated with batch processing.

Which of the following CAATs allow fictitious transactions planted by the auditor to be processed along with real ones on client's system?

  1. Integrated test facility

  2. Test data approach

  3. Generalised audit software

  4. Parallel simulation

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
A Correct answer
Explanation

The Integrated Test Facility (ITF) involves creating a dummy entity (like a department or branch) within the client's system. Auditors then process test transactions through this dummy entity alongside real transactions to verify system integrity.
